The Historical Footprint of Slot Machines: From Casinos to Digital Platforms

Initially introduced in physical casinos in the late 19th century, mechanical slot machines like Liberty Bell revolutionized gambling entertainment. Moving into the digital era, online slots emerged in the late 1990s, driven by the proliferation of internet connectivity and the desire to replicate brick-and-mortar excitement virtually.

Early online slots maintained basic mechanics—3-reel configurations with limited paylines. However, rapid technological advancements paved the way for more complex features, including multiple paylines, bonus rounds, and themed narratives, significantly enhancing engagement.

The Phenomenon of Megaways and Innovative Features

Recent innovations have set new industry standards. The Megaways mechanic, pioneered by Big Time Gaming, introduced variable reel setups that dramatically increased the number of potential winning combinations—up to 117,649 ways in many titles. This innovation exemplifies how game design continues to push the boundaries of player experience, blending randomness with strategic anticipation.

Furthermore, features such as cascading reels, expanding wilds, free spins, and multi-layered bonus games foster a more interactive environment that incentivizes prolonged engagement, an essential factor in player retention.

Technological Enablers: From HTML5 to Virtual Reality

The shift from Flash-based platforms to HTML5 has been pivotal, allowing for seamless gameplay across desktops and mobile devices, which now account for over 70% of online gaming traffic globally (Statista, 2023). This ubiquity necessitates high-quality graphics, intuitive controls, and compelling sound design—levels of immersion previously confined to console gaming.

Looking ahead, vir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) are emerging as frontiers. While still exploratory, these technologies promise fully immersive casino environments, elevating player interaction beyond passive spinning to active, social experiences.

Data-Driven Personalization and Responsible Gaming

Another evolution pivotal to industry credibility involves data analytics. Platforms can now adapt game recommendations based on user behavior, optimize onboarding, and promote responsible gaming measures—imposing limits, offering self-assessment tools, and providing real-time support.

For instance, analytics can identify patterns indicating problematic gambling, allowing operators to intervene proactively, which aligns with industry standards and regulatory requirements. This responsible approach is critical as markets grow and regulatory scrutiny intensifies.
